Summary:Background. The Irtysh River is an important water resource for the three countries through whose territory it flows - China, Kazakhstan, and Russia. It is a supplier of valuable ecosystem services, the volume of which directly depends on the economic activities of user countries. To improve the efficiency of water resource use within the framework of the concept of sustainable development, the UN proposes to use an ecosystem approach. An analysis of the literature on this issue showed that an assessment of the Russian section of the Irtysh River from the point of view of its provision of ecosystem services has not yet been carried out. The purpose of the research was to determine the composition, content and volumes of ecosystem services in the Russian section of the transboundary Irtysh River. Materials and methods. The composition and content of ecosystem services of the Irtysh River were determined using the UN methodology (Millennium Ecosystem Assessment, 2005). Information was gathered from official Internet sources and peer-reviewed journals. Results. The study showed that the Russian section of the Irtysh, covering its middle and lower reaches, provides all types of ecosystem services. Among the resource-providing services of the river, economic priority is given to water intake and sand extraction, the volumes of which have reached the maximum possible level. High potential for the development of certain types of resource-providing and cultural ecosystem services has been identified. The significance and content of the regulating and supporting ecosystem services of the Irtysh are revealed, their role in the conservation of biological diversity through the functioning of specially protected natural areas located near the river is outlined. Conclusion. The results can be applied to realize the potential of ecosystem services of the Irtysh River and improve the efficiency of its management. EDN: FGXUYZ
